Output 3ecac56ca1fdd1eda0babdeb9a286ee7d330e65f57fbcdfd32f65380390ad099:10

value
527039
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8dba4a4a395a91a920691706a31135e7d45928f4 OP_EQUAL
address
3EcQNG7zCpQBVKmWZfcBMNPCVA8HBZnGxH
transaction
3ecac56ca1fdd1eda0babdeb9a286ee7d330e65f57fbcdfd32f65380390ad099
spent
true